diff --git a/memberlist.php b/memberlist.php
index 70aee828..691a484b 100644
--- a/memberlist.php
+++ b/memberlist.php
@@ -143,9 +143,9 @@ for ($i=224, $cnt=255; $i <= $cnt; $i++)
}
$select_letter .= ': ';
-$select_letter .= ($by_letter == 'others') ? ''. $lang['OTHERS'] .' ' : ''. $lang['OTHERS'] .' ';
+$select_letter .= (strtoupper($by_letter) == 'others') ? ''. $lang['OTHERS'] .' ' : ''. $lang['OTHERS'] .' ';
$select_letter .= ': ';
-$select_letter .= ($by_letter == 'all') ? ''. $lang['ALL'] .'' : ''. $lang['ALL'] .'';
+$select_letter .= (strtoupper($by_letter) == 'all') ? ''. $lang['ALL'] .'' : ''. $lang['ALL'] .'';
$template->assign_vars(array(
'S_LETTER_SELECT' => $select_letter,